Cell-Free Circularization of Viroid Progeny RNA by an RNA Ligase from Wheat Germ

ANDREA D. BRANCH 1, HUGH D. ROBERTSON 1, CHRISTOPHER GREER 2, PETER GEGENHEIMER 2, CRAIG PEEBLES 2, and JOHN ABELSON 2

1 Laboratory of Genetics, Rockefeller University, New York 10021
2 Department of Chemistry, University of California, San Diego, La Jolla, 92093

Linear, potato spindle tuber viroid RNA has been used as a substrate for an RNA ligase purified from wheat germ. Linear viroid molecules are efficiently converted to circular molecules (circles) which are indistinguishable by electrophoretic mobility and two-dimensional oligonucleotide pattern from viroid circles extracted from infected plants. In light of recent evidence for multimeric viroid replication intermediates, cleavage followed by RNA ligation by a cellular enzyme may (i) be a normal step in the viroid life cycle and (ii) may also reflect cellular events.
